Preliminary examination to Turkish universities to be held in Kazan

18 March 2010, Thursday
The preliminary admission examination (TCS – Test of Cognitive Skills) to the Turkish Republic universities will be held in Kazan on April 25, Tatarstan Ministry of Education and Science press-service informs.

High school graduates with full secondary education and this-year school-leavers under the age of 24 can take part in the exam. It will be held in test format.

Promising students with poor language proficiency will be sent for one year of pre-study courses. Students will be provided with the Turkish Republic government scholarship and dormitory residency. Students will be financially responsible for travel expenses.
